    Abstract: A multi-function sound chamber for a handheld barcode reader may include the ability to (i) amplify or otherwise efficiently project an audible signal generated by a buzzer of the barcode reader to sound window(s), and (ii) provide stiffening support to a printed circuit board (PCB) on which an electromechanical switch is mounted that a trigger of the handheld barcode reader engages when activated by a user of the reader. The sound chamber may provide other functions, including isolating light between good/bad read signals and battery level status. Another function may include reducing electrostatic discharge (ESD) by providing a high-impedance seal around connecting screws. Another function may include retention of the PCB by providing a pocket with a compliant material to retain a top or other edge of the PCB. By having the sound chamber perform multiple functions, the barcode reader may be produced more efficiently and cost effectively.

    Abstract: Systems and methods for establishing optimal reading conditions for a machine-readable symbol reader. A machine-readable symbol reader may selectively control reading conditions including lighting conditions (e.g., illumination pattern), focus, decoder library parameters (e.g., exposure time, gain), etc. Deep learning and optimization algorithms (e.g., greedy search algorithms) are used to autonomously learn an optimal set of reading parameters to be used for the reader in a particular application. A deep learning network (e.g., a convolutional neural network) may be used to locate machine-readable symbols in images captured by the reader, and greedy search algorithms may be used to determine a reading distance parameter and one or more illumination parameters during an autonomous learning phase of the reader.

    Abstract: Systems and methods for preventing the unauthorized removal of mobile processor-based devices from designated areas (e.g., inside of a shopping area). The system may utilize a beacon technology based on a low energy protocol to prevent unauthorized removal of the devices. An anti-theft beacon system which includes an RF beacon transmitter may be positioned proximate an exit of a designated area. Mobile processor-based devices detect beacon signals from the anti-theft beacon system. Responsive to such detection, a device determines that it has been removed from the designated area. The device may then perform one or more anti-theft actions, including operating as a beacon once removed from the designated area. An auxiliary power source may power a beacon of the mobile processor-based device when the mobile processor-based device has been removed from the designated area so that the beacon may still broadcast signals even when a primary power source is disabled.

    Abstract: A system and method for localizing an area of interest likely containing a digital watermark is disclosed. Image frames may be segmented into multiple tiles. A pixel having the maximum grayscale or other value and a pixel having the minimum grayscale or other value in each tile may be identified. Maximum and minimum image maps may be generated from the image frame by replacing each tile with the respective maximum and minimum grayscale or other value pixels. A background map may be generated based on a moving average of the grayscale values of the pixels in the image maps. Foreground map(s) may be generated based on the difference of the values from the image maps to the background map. A region of interest may be determined based on the background and foreground maps and provided to a watermark decoder. Content contained in the digital watermark may be read.

    Abstract: A beacon anchor may include a signal generator configured to generate an ultra-wide band signal inclusive of a unique identifier associated with the beacon anchor, where the UWB signal is a pulse sequence. A transceiver may be in communications with the signal generator. Responsive to receiving the UWB signal from the signal generator, the UWB signal may be broadcast. A processing unit may be in communication with the transceiver, and, responsive to receiving a unicast communications session request from a portable device, be configured to establish a unicast communications session with the portable device to enable a distance between the portable device and beacon anchor to be determined. Through use of UWB signals, relative position (e.g., in front of or behind the beacon anchor) may be determined, thereby enabling different actions to be taken in response to determining the relative position.

    Abstract: The invention relates to a method and a system for reading coded information from an object. The system comprises one or more three-dimensional cameras configured such as to capture three-dimensional images of the object and a processor configured such as to process the captured three-dimensional images. The processor is designed to: identify planes upon which faces of the object lie; extract two-dimensional images that lie on the identified planes; and apply coded information recognition algorithms to at least part of the extracted two-dimensional images.
